Tractor Supply Company Buys 100-Acre AZ Site for New Distribution Center

11/19/14

Tractor Supply Company recently acquired a 100-acre development site within the Central Arizona Commerce Park in Casa Grande, AZ. Tractor Supply, the largest rural lifestyle retail store chain in the United States, will build a 650k sf distribution center on the land.

The project is expected to create more than 250 local jobs. The development just broke ground on November 17, and is expected to be up and operating in the fourth quarter of 2015.

Central Arizona Commerce Park is a 416-acre, rail-served industrial park near the confluence of I-8 and I-10, between Phoenix and Tucson, and with direct access to the state’s main rail line. The multi-phase project is designed to accommodate both large and smaller users, and is supported by a strong local workforce. Other nearby major corporate neighbors include Frito Lay, Walmart and Abbott Labs.

Bill Honsaker, Anthony Lydon and Marc Hertzberg of JLL are the exclusive brokers for Central Arizona Commerce Park.
